Publisher Description
Intelligence agent Todd Belknap is fired after a mission goes wrong - now he's a lone operative on the loose...
When Todd Belknap's best friend goes missing, it seems that a mysterious figure, known only as 'Genesis', is responsible.
Meanwhile, hedge fund analyst Andrea Newton gets an unexpected call. She has been left a fortune by a cousin she's never met - on the condition that she joins the board of the charitable Bancroft Foundation. Yet the foundation appears less and less benign the more deeply involved she becomes.
As events escalate, and Genesis appears to be working to destabilise governments, Todd and Andrea must form an uneasy alliance if they are to uncover the truth - before it's too late...
PUBLISHERS WEEKLY
The latest international thriller to appear under Ludlum's name, with its by-the-numbers plot and stereotypical characters, fails to do justice to the late author, who made his mark with such taut and compelling novels as The Scarlatti Inheritance and The Bourne Identity. Maverick U.S. intelligence agent Todd Belknap, known as the Hound for his superior ability to track his quarry, heads to Lebanon to try to find a fellow agent who has been kidnapped. Meanwhile, Andrea Bancroft, a brainy and beautiful hedge-fund analyst who has agreed to serve on the board of her family's mysterious foundation, begins to suspect that behind the Bancroft Foundation's benevolent facade lie sinister conspiracies. Unsurprisingly, those conspiracies intersect with Belknap's search. Throw in a secret cabal controlling world events and a high body count, and you have predictable genre fare. 600,000 first printing.
